Group 2
| Month | Race Name | Racecourse | Dist. (m) | Age/Sex |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 001 April | Prix d'Harcourt | Longchamp | 2,000 | 4yo+ |
| 002 April | Prix Noailles | Longchamp | 2,100 | 3yo c&f |
| 003 May | Prix du Muguet | Saint-Cloud | 1,600 | 4yo+ |
| 004 May | Prix Greffulhe | Saint-Cloud | 2,000 | 3yo c&f |
| 005 May | Prix Hocquart | Longchamp | 2,200 | 3yo c&f |
| 006 May | Prix Vicomtesse Vigier | Longchamp | 3,100 | 4yo+ |
| 007 May / June | Prix Corrida | Saint-Cloud | 2,100 | 4yo+ f |
| 008 May / June | Prix de Sandringham | Chantilly | 1,600 | 3yo f |
| 009 May / June | Grand Prix de Chantilly | Chantilly | 2,400 | 4yo+ |
| 010 May / June | Prix du Gros Chêne | Chantilly | 1,000 | 3yo+ |
| 011 June / July | Prix de Malleret | Saint-Cloud | 2,400 | 3yo f |
| 012 July | Prix Maurice de Nieuil | Longchamp | 2,800 | 4yo+ |
| 013 July | Prix Robert Papin | Maisons-Laffitte | 1,100 | 2yo c&f |
| 014 July | Prix Eugène Adam | Maisons-Laffitte | 2,000 | 3yo |
| 015 August | Prix de Pomone | Deauville | 2,500 | 3yo+ f |
| 016 August | Prix Guillaume d'Ornano | Deauville | 2,000 | 3yo |
| 017 August | Prix Kergorlay | Deauville | 3,000 | 3yo+ |
| 018 August | Prix de la Nonette | Deauville | 2,000 | 3yo f |
| 019 August | Grand Prix de Deauville | Deauville | 2,500 | 3yo+ |
| 020 September | Prix Niel | Longchamp | 2,400 | 3yo c&f |
| 021 September | Prix Foy | Longchamp | 2,400 | 4yo+ c&f |
| 022 Sept / Oct | Prix Chaudenay | Longchamp | 3,000 | 3yo |
| 023 Sept / Oct | Prix de Royallieu | Longchamp | 2,500 | 3yo+ f |
| 024 Sept / Oct | Prix Dollar | Longchamp | 1,950 | 3yo+ |
| 025 Sept / Oct | Prix Daniel Wildenstein | Longchamp | 1,600 | 3yo+ |
| 026 October | Prix du Conseil de Paris | Longchamp | 2,400 | 3yo+ |
| 027 Oct / Nov | Critérium de Maisons-Laffitte | Maisons-Laffitte | 1,200 | 2yo |
